    <title>2001 (2) TMI 185 - CEGAT, NEW DELHI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=50474</link>
    <description>Penalty under Section 11AC of the Central Excise Act was treated as discretionary up to the duty amount, so it was reduced to Rs. 5 lakhs because the duty liability was undisputed and part had already been paid before the first adjudication order. Interest under Section 11AB was sustained because there was no material separating clearances made after 28-9-1996 from earlier clearances, leaving the interest liability intact. The penalties imposed on the other appellants under the Central Excise Rules were also sustained, as no sufficient ground was shown for interference and the duty demand itself remained undisputed.</description>
